There are things that will wake the drive up independent of any issues in the firmware. For example, when your DHCP lease expires, the system will wake up to renew the lease.

As a status, this issue is still being worked on. Drive standby is a tricky thing to do in a linux kernel. You have to be very careful that no processes are touching the data volume while the drive is in standby. Getting that done is no small feat. With all the new code and services added to the 2.x software, this is even more complicated. Weā€™ll get it done, just taking a bit of time.
